    Currency Conversion in Excel

    Hello All.

    I have a spreadsheet with data, whose data elements includes price of parts and the appropriate currency values. I would like to have a new column which would have all the net price in USD. The thing is the data of issue of these orders are over 3 years and each period has a different conversion rate. Is there a way by which I can make the conversion according to the appropriate conversion rates in the respective periods of time?

    Re: Currency Conversion in Excel

    One I found is here:

    http://www.oanda.com/currency/histor...margin_fixed=0

    you can enter a from/to date, select the currency and then click Get Table...

    you can repeat for each year and each currency of interest...then copy/paste to Excel and add a currency column to identify the currency...
